Abstract
In this chapter, we will look at the case of children and youth in conflict, particularly with regard to their vulnerability as refugees and migrants who have little control over their own lives, as seen in recent and striking images of the distress around this. The chapter will provide a global overview of the problem, explore the particular vulnerabilities of children in conflict, in transit and in transposed locations and specifically examine problems facing these vulnerable groups in the MENA region. This chapter will conclude with a discussion on fostering safety and resilience for these children.
